Representative Nemes introduced House Bill 375,
a TERM LIMIT bill:
Representative Nemes co-principled House Bill 382:
This bill passed and was signed into law.
HB 382 basically keeps predators away from accident
victims for 30 days.
Representative Nemes co-sponsored House Bills:
1 - 36 - 37 - 58 - 90 - 144 - 208 - 236 - 274 - 422
During the session, 653 bills and 587 resolutions were introduced.
99 bills became law.
